Teaching style

⭐In the school library I try to provide as much choice to students as possible.  I employ a lot of stations and tictactoe style activities in which students can choose how they would like to show me what they have learned.  Our school just got our first set of Ipads and I am anxious to incorporate these into our classroom as well.   ⭐Cooperative learning and community building are the glue of the learning community and I will never give either up.  I operate on the principles that every student wants to talk, move, and have fun so I try to incorporate as much of each into every day we have together.
